The hit sounds of ’60s singing sensation Petula Clark headline 'Portrait of Petula Clark,' crooning onto DVD March 17 from Infinity Home Entertainment.

This colorful look back at the pop music world of 1969, filmed in Paris, London, Geneva, New York and Los Angeles, includes Clark performing her worldwide smash hits “I Know a Place” and “My Love.” In addition, she offers enchanting renditions of “This Girl's in Love With You,” “My Funny Valentine,” “When I Was a Child,” “Mademoiselle de Paris” and the beautiful ballad “You and I,” from the motion picture Goodbye, Mr. Chips.

Crooner Andy Williams duets with Clark on the lovely “Visions of Sugar Plums” and the playful “You Can't Rollerskate in a Buffalo Herd” (written by Roger Miller). Williams also sings “Happy Heart,” a hit for both him and Clark. French vocalist Sacha Distel performs “Love is Blue” and joins Clark and Williams for “The Poor People of Paris.” British actor Ron Moody appears as his character Fagin from the film Oliver and teams with Clark for song and dance.
